Ryanair has unveiled a fresh flight route connecting Teesside International Airport to Malaga as part of its winter timetable, featuring nine brand-new destinations.
The new service to the beloved Spanish holiday hotspot will run twice each week on Wednesdays and Saturdays, offering a flight duration of slightly more than three hours to the beloved Spanish resort.
The remaining eight destinations Ryanair launching from Malaga will include Bratislava in Slovakia, Lübeck and Münster in Germany, Stockholm Västeras in Sweden, Warsaw in Poland and three Czech Republic flight routes.
